Solution

The correct option is D

8:5


Given: r:h=3:4 Let r=3x and h=4x

In the above figure, BC=r=3x and h=AB=4x

In ABC

AB2+BC2=AC2

16x2+9x2=AC2

AC=25x2=5x

Slant height of the cone is l=5x

Required ratio=total surface areacurved surface area=πr(r+l)πrl

=π×3x(3x+5x)π×3x×5x

=8:5
